Ringfort, Bullaun, Co. Galway

A small oval enclosure on a north-facing grassland slope in County Galway answers to the local name 'Lisheen', a diminutive of the Irish word for a fairy fort, and the name alone tells you something about how the people living around it chose to regard it.

The site is a rath, the most common form of early medieval farmstead in Ireland, typically consisting of a circular or oval area enclosed by one or more earthen banks with a ditch between them. This one is in poor condition, but its outline can still be read: roughly 42 metres north to south and just under 30 metres east to west, with two banks and an intervening fosse running from the west around through the north to the east. A later field wall cuts across the monument at both the eastern and western sides, and to the south the enclosing element survives only as a scarp, a low slope in the ground where the original bank has been eroded or spread.

What makes this particular rath quietly interesting is a detail passed down through local knowledge rather than formal excavation. Somewhere within the interior, there was apparently a cist burial grave, a type of prehistoric stone-lined burial cut into the ground, often predating the ringforts that were later built nearby or directly over them. The relationship between earlier burial monuments and later settlement enclosures is not unusual in the Irish archaeological record, though whether the rath was deliberately sited beside or over a known grave, or whether the association is coincidental, cannot be said without excavation. Just outside the western edge of the enclosure, a series of hollows in the ground may be the remains of quarrying activity, adding another layer of human use to a patch of land that has clearly meant something to different people across a very long stretch of time.
